After a drab 1-1 draw against Macclesfield on Tuesday night, the full time whistle gave way to a chorus of boo's at Don Valley stadium.

The Swinton born 22 year old Miller gave his thoughts to the 'Tiser; "Obviously the fans weren't happy the other night but we need them to be behind us and we need that extra push. I know we should have it ourselves but you don't have it every game and you need fans there supporting you." he said.

"I'm not saying, 'if you see someone do something bad, cheer them.' Just give them a lift. We know when we're having a bad time and hitting a bit of a sticky patch. We're not meaning to make mistakes."

"We knew what their game plan would be and we tried to play out from the back to find the strikers' chests and work from there, but it was disappointing the match went. We didn't have a high enough tempo in the final third and we didn't get the ball wide enough times."

"Credit to Alfie, he got us out of trouble again but if we'd been a bit more committed to get on the end of things then we would have been better off."

With the Millers league form stuttering, Ryan is happy with a break with 2 cup games coming up; "We're having a blip but we want to get out of it and we will get out of it because we've got the players who can. The gaffer shouldn't be worried and the lads aren't worried. If we start moving the ball about and scoring goals then the fans will soon change."he said
